I think the material which is the easiest do drop is PF# 5 . While it's a great dungeon with quite some memorable encounters it doesn't seem to be too connected with the rest of the AP and isn't absolutely necessary story-wise (xp is another thing). You basically can let your PC learn all they need in the library in PF #4 and from there send them directly into the events of PF #6.

Where are you right now?
If you haven't started yet, you could conceivably start with higher-level characters and skip the first couple of adventures entirely - they're not too connected to the rest (at least not obviously - the GM will know the difference) and are more a Grand Introduction To Golarion (especially Varisia).
